Transaction d8abc877a28b8549cc5ed6a677c5b88bbc2cd37c91f249d0c1aa93b47a060660
1 Input
1 Output
-
d8abc877a28b8549cc5ed6a677c5b88bbc2cd37c91f249d0c1aa93b47a060660:0
- value
- 289389
- script pubkey
- OP_0 OP_PUSHBYTES_20 365811d2afa66aea5c75e9ab6192b157d129eacb
- address
- bc1qxevpr5405e4w5hr4ax4kry432lgjn6kt9ske7p